"Pro-tip: You can get BOGO free deals from Facebook advertisements. You can ask to sample the soft serve swirl-ins. Highlights: Their concept of swirl-in flavors is really unique and I've never seen it before. I like the concept of a dipped cone, but I thought theirs was a bit thick and I could have done with a lighter dipping so it wasn't as overwhelming. Really appreciated them letting us sample the swirl in because we ultimately ended up changing our order based on the sample. Lowlights: While the swirl in concept is neat, I really wish they had a way to incorporate more the swirl in flavors as it ends up being 95% a vanilla cone. Without the BOGO free deal, I think it's a touch expensive for what's essentially a simple soft serve, in a sugar cone that's the same one at McDonalds, and it's overall pretty short. They had someone training make one of ours and immediately I noticed it was shorter and not done as well which is disappointing."
